Industrial frequency transformer impact current suppression circuit, industrial frequency transformer and intrinsically safe power supply

The invention provides an industrial frequency transformer impact current suppression circuit. The industrial frequency transformer impact current suppression circuit comprises an energy taking unit arranged on a fire wire of a transformer, a rectification unit electrically connected with the output end of the energy taking unit, a constant voltage unit electrically connected with the rectification unit and a current suppression unit electrically connected with the output end of the constant voltage unit, and the current suppression unit is arranged on the fire wire of the transformer and electrically connected with a fuse F1 of the transformer. Most input voltages can be loaded on a current limiting resistor in the power-on process, all the voltages loaded on the current limiting resistor are loaded at the two input ends of the transformer after the power-on process, therefore, large impact currents cannot be generated by the transformer at the starting-up moment, meanwhile, potential differences are prevented from being generated on the current limiting resistor, the fuse can be effectively prevented from being burnt out by the impacts of the large currents, and the fault rate of the fuse of the industrial frequency transformer is lowered. In addition, high cost caused by transformer power increase through the mode of increasing rated currents of the fuse can be avoided.

Lead storage battery production method, lead storage battery, electrolyte production method and electrolyte

The invention relates to a lead storage battery production method, a lead storage battery, an electrolyte production method and an electrolyte. The lead storage battery production method comprises anelectrolyte production process, wherein during the electrolyte production process, distilled water is treated into small-molecular-group distilled water through water electrifying equipment and is then mixed with pure sulfuric acid. The electrolyte prepared by adopting the method is small in moleculer group number, and after the electrolyte is mixed with the sulfuric acid, a sulfuric acid solutionis more uniform. If the sulfuric acid and the water are mixed more uniformly, the current density distribution of a pole plate is more uniformly when the pole plate is charged and discharged, the potential difference of different parts of the battery is avoided, the polarization of the battery is reduced, meanwhile, the resistance of the pole plate can be reduced, the exothermic reaction of the battery during charging is reduced, and active substances can more favorably participate in charging and discharging, so that the charging acceptability of the storage battery is improved. In addition,a method for increasing the specific energy of the battery through only replacing the electrolyte not only can be accomplished at the design production stage of the battery, but also can be used on amature product and a recycled product.

Method for solving skip plating of fixed position of PCB (Printed Circuit Board) caused by battery effect

The invention discloses a method for solving skip plating of a fixed position of a PCB (Printed Circuit Board) caused by a battery effect, which comprises the following steps of: providing a production board, arranging a solder resist windowing position to be subjected to nickel-gold immersion treatment and antioxidant treatment on the production board so as to expose a PAD, and arranging a non-plated-through hole and a plated-through hole on the production board; the PAD comprises a first PAD connected with the non-plated-through hole, a second PAD connected with the plated-through hole and/or a third PAD not connected with the hole; wherein the first PAD is subjected to nickel-gold deposition treatment, the second PAD connected with the plated-through hole and the plated-through hole are subjected to nickel-gold deposition treatment or anti-oxidation treatment at the same time, and the third PAD with the distance smaller than 20 mil s from the plated-through hole and the plated-through hole are subjected to nickel-gold deposition treatment at the same time; after a film is pasted on the production board, windowing is conducted on the positions corresponding to the non-plated-through holes and the positions to be subjected to nickel and gold immersion treatment; carrying out chemical nickel and gold immersion treatment on the production board; and after the film is removed, the production board is subjected to anti-oxidation treatment. The method effectively solves the problem of skip plating of the PAD in the prior art.
